Yangon Jade Pearls and Gems Auction

Published August 27th, 2008


Myanmar announced on Wednesday it would hold an October auction of Jade, pearls and precious gems in Yangon, despite economic sanctions banning their international trade.

At a previous sale in March, 7,700 lots were sold, valued at more than 100 million euros (153 million dollars).

The United States blocked imports of Myanmar’s gems in July, passing new legislation to prevent the gems entering US markets.
